Botswana College of Distance and Open Learning (BOCODOL) has been formed to improve access to learning opportunities on a nation wide scale for the out of school young adults. Open learning seeks to break down the barriers to personal development by providing flexible learning environments, enabling people to study what is relevant to their needs, at a time and place convenient to them. The learners learn from specially designed study materials which use a combination of different types of media, methods and communication technologies, rather than through direct face-to-face mode of instruction as in conventional schools. In this way distance education allows them to study at home or in their workplace, at their own pace without having to leave their families or job commitments. The college is also faced with the task of broadening types of courses it offers to include vocationl, professional management and other programmes in addition to Junior Certificate (JC) and Botswana General Certificate in Secondary Education (BGCSE). <P> |
